Opponents of corporal punishment argue presenting parents and students with the choice of the paddle or a suspension — which research also shows is ineffective and comes with a host of negative consequences — is disingenuous. Families, faced with the prospect of missed learning time and a daytime scramble for childcare, opt for the faster, physical discipline and a return to class. For instance, a large analysis of 88 corporal punishment studies found that children who were physically punished were more likely to be aggressive, show antisocial behavior and have lower mental health.
